centos 做跳板机登录云服务器

云服务器为了保证安全,对外不提供外网访问的端口,往往需要加上跳板机或者堡垒机,要不然就是搭建VPN,这里只讲一下跳板机的搭建。

需要的资源:
1、公司一台可以提供外网服务的服务器
2、阿里云等云服务器

配置的步骤:
1、使用xshell登录到跳板机,为了秘钥文件的安全,将高级下面的这几项直接勾上
这里写图片描述
2、修改~/.ssh/config 文件,修改的命令为:

vi ~/.ssh/config

文件的内容

Host tiaobanji
HostName XXX
Port XXX
User XXX


Host web_master
HostName XXXX
port XXXX
User XXXX
ProxyCommand ssh root@tiaobanji -W %h:%p

其中:
Host 主机别名
HostName 主机的外网Ip
Port 主机登录的端口号
User 主机登录的用户名
ProxyCommand :代理执行的命令

3、使用 ssh web_master 命令就可以登录到云服务上,因为Xshell勾选了高级选项,所以需要双方密码。

ssh web_master

这里写图片描述

4、当然如果觉得上诉方法太麻烦,也可以执行执行命令

ssh username@目标机器ip -p 22 -o ProxyCommand='ssh -p 22 username@跳板机ip -W %h:%p'

猜你喜欢

转载自blog.csdn.net/sunyuhua_keyboard/article/details/81198329